Minister of Higher Education and Training, Buti Manamela.
Labour union, National Education, Health and Allied Workers’ Union (Nehawu) has strongly criticised Higher Education Minister Buti Manamela’s decision to place NSFAS under administration.

The union says previous administrators caused decay through maladministration and financial irregularities.
It referred to the former Auditor-General, Kimi Makwetu’s findings for the 2018/19 financial year that revealed R7.5 billion irregular expenditure – an increase from R30.5 million in the previous year.
Manamela appointed Professor Hlengani Mathebula as administrator of NSFAS.
